Why Laptop Cooling Is Important

Heat is one of the biggest enemies of computer hardware. When internal components such as the CPU and GPU generate heat, the system needs a way to dissipate it. A cooling fan for laptop works by circulating air inside the device and pushing hot air out through ventilation areas.

Without effective cooling fans, laptops may experience reduced performance due to thermal throttling. This process slows down the processor to prevent overheating. Over time, excessive heat can also shorten the lifespan of critical components like the motherboard, processor, and storage devices.

Proper cooling not only improves performance but also protects your investment in computer hardware.

How Cooling Fans Work

Cooling fans are designed to move air across heat-producing components. When the processor begins to heat up, sensors trigger the fan to spin faster. This airflow carries heat away from the internal components and helps maintain safe operating temperatures.

Many users are familiar with cooling fans for PC systems, where large fans are installed inside desktop cases. In laptops, however, space is limited. This means manufacturers design compact but efficient cooling systems that combine heat pipes and specialized fans to control temperature.

Benefits of Using Laptop Cooling Fans

Cooling fans provide several advantages for laptop users. First, they help maintain consistent performance by preventing overheating. When a laptop stays cool, the processor can run at its full potential.

Second, cooling fans protect internal components from heat-related damage. Excessive heat can weaken circuits and cause hardware failure over time.

Another important benefit is improved system stability. When temperatures remain balanced, laptops are less likely to freeze, crash, or shut down unexpectedly.
